LDAP Integration

I'm hearing more and more about larger companies requiring that their secure and managed file transfer solution integrate with their LDAP database for end user authentication.

This type of integration enables company-wide solution deployment with centralized user management control for thousands of employees.

NEW WEBINAR: PCI DSS and Secure File Transfer

PCI DSS compliance requires any organization that accepts or processes credit card transactions to protect the security, privacy and confidentiality of cardholder information... AND to document who accesses it, and the security measures (including encryption) that are taken to prevent theft, loss, or accidental disclosure.

Of course, as with most compliance initiatives, PCI DSS compliance is more complicated and far-reaching than it initially looks.
